- The distance between Picos, Brazil and New Orleans, Louisiana, Usa is approximately 6,634 km or 4,123 mi.
- To reach Picos in this distance one would set out from New Orleans, Louisiana bearing 120.1°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Picos bearing 131° or SE .
- Picos has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as New Orleans, Louisiana has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Picos is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as New Orleans, Louisiana is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 9.4 °C (16.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.1 °C (21.8°F) less in Picos.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 759.4 mm (29.9 in) less which is equivalent to 759.4 l/m² (18.64 US gal/ft²) or 7,594,000 l/ha (811,849 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.7° higher in Picos than in New Orleans, Louisiana.
- Relative humidity levels are 2.7%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 6°C (10.7°F) higher.
